摘要

In this paper, a novel phase-shifted pulse width modulation (PS-PWM) automatic voltage regulator (AVR) with fast voltage control and reduced total harmonics is proposed. The novel PS-PWM AVR is made up of an AC/AC converter with reversible voltage control and a transformer for series voltage compensation. In the active rectifier, a proper switching operation is achieved without the problem of power factor correction. The AVR uses a fully digital controller, which is implemented by a fixed-point digital signal processor (DSP) TMS320F240 DSP-based board. Therefore, the proposed AVR gives high efficiency and reliability. It is also shown via some experimental results that the presented novel PS-PWM AVR gives good performance for high quality of the output voltage.
